The Ministry of Foreign Affairs says it has asked Indonesia to clarify a joint naval exercise east of Taiwan announced by China.
The statement comes after China's defense ministry announced that joint Chinese-Indonesian Naval navigation exercises would be taking place.
According to the foreign ministry, it "immediately contacted relevant parties" to learn more about the situation and asked the Indonesian side for clarification after China "unilaterally claimed" Indonesia would participate in the drill.
The ministry say it has "sternly condemned" what it's describing as China's "arbitrary and irresponsible" behavior, saying Beijing has again disregarded international norms and responsibilities and "further increased tensions in the region."
